The management of the Bulgarian Volleyball Federation discussed future cooperation with Ruse Municipality

The Mayor of Ruse Municipality, Pencho Milkov, and his team welcomed today representatives of the Bulgarian Volleyball Federation to a working meeting. The President of the BFV, Lyubomir Ganev, and David Davidov, Chairman of the Youth and Junior Volleyball Commission (KYUDV), participated in it. The two discussed important topics for the development and popularization of the beloved sport in the city.

The discussion covered both the possibility of future cooperation between the BFV and Ruse Municipality, as well as the holding of events from the federation's calendar over the next two years. Among the topics highlighted was the interaction between the municipality and the volleyball clubs in the city.

"Ruse has always been a very volleyball-oriented city. My journey in this sport also started here," recalled Ganev, who is a native of the Danube-side town. "In recent years, the city has also shown itself on the international stage as an excellent host, hosting the Men's World Championship in 2018 and the Women's Volleyball Nations League in 2019. It has the conditions, it has the people who love the sport, it also has the talents – we must ensure that volleyball can develop in this territory and ignite more people, as it has been over the years. We count on Ruse Municipality as a partner."

"Over the years, the city of Ruse has proven to be an extremely hospitable host, and the local audience has always provided great support for our national teams. In this sense, we will seek opportunities for closer cooperation and organizing volleyball events in the city," said David Davidov, Chairman of the KYUDV.
